az security security-connector create

Preview

Command group 'az security security-connector' is in preview and under development. Reference and support levels: https://aka.ms/CLI_refstatus

Create a security connector.

az security security-connector create --name
                                      --resource-group
                                      [--environment-data]
                                      [--environment-name {AWS, Azure, AzureDevOps, GCP, GitLab, Github}]
                                      [--hierarchy-identifier]
                                      [--location]
                                      [--offerings]
                                      [--tags]

Examples

Onboard AWS Environment with CspmMonitor Offering

az security security-connectors create --location EastUS --name awsConnector --resource-group myResourceGroup --hierarchy-identifier 123456789555 --environment-name AWS --offerings [0].cspm-monitor-aws.native_cloud_connection.cloudRoleArn='arn:aws:iam::123456789555:role/CspmMonitorAws' --environment-data aws-account.scan-interval=24 aws-account.organizational-data.organization.stackset-name=myStackName aws-account.organizational-data.organization.excluded-account-ids="['100000000000', '100000000001']"

Onboard GCP Environment with CspmMonitor and DefenderCSPM Offerings

az security security-connectors create --location EastUS --name gcpConnector --resource-group myResourceGroup --hierarchy-identifier 123456555 --environment-name GCP --environment-data gcp-project.scan-interval=12 gcp-project.project-details.project-id=mdc-mgmt-proj-123456555 gcp-project.project-details.project-number=123456555 gcp-project.organizational-data.organization.service-account-email-address="mdc-onboarding-sa@mdc-mgmt-proj-123456555.iam.gserviceaccount.com" gcp-project.organizational-data.organization.workload-identity-provider-id=auto-provisioner gcp-project.organizational-data.organization.excluded-project-numbers=[] --offerings [0].cspm-monitor-gcp.native-cloud-connection.service-account-email-address="microsoft-defender-cspm@mdc-mgmt-proj-123456555.iam.gserviceaccount.com" [0].cspm-monitor-gcp.native-cloud-connection.workload-identity-provider-id=cspm [1].defender-cspm-gcp.vm-scanners.enabled=true [1].defender-cspm-gcp.vm-scanners.configuration.scanning-mode=Default [1].defender-cspm-gcp.mdc-containers-agentless-discovery-k8s.enabled=true [1].defender-cspm-gcp.mdc-containers-agentless-discovery-k8s.service-account-email-address="mdc-containers-k8s-operator@mdc-mgmt-proj-123456555.iam.gserviceaccount.com" [1].defender-cspm-gcp.mdc-containers-agentless-discovery-k8s.workload-identity-provider-id=containers [1].defender-cspm-gcp.ciem-discovery.azure-active-directory-app-name=mciem-gcp-oidc-app [1].defender-cspm-gcp.mdc-containers-agentless-discovery-k8s.workload-identity-provider-id=containers [1].defender-cspm-gcp.ciem-discovery.workload-identity-provider-id=ciem-discovery [1].defender-cspm-gcp.ciem-discovery.service-account-email-address="microsoft-defender-ciem@mdc-mgmt-proj-123456555.iam.gserviceaccount.com"

Onboard AzureDevOps Environment

az security security-connectors create --location CentralUS --name adoConnector --resource-group myResourceGroup --hierarchy-identifier 8b090c71-cfba-494d-87a6-e10b321a0d98 --environment-name AzureDevOps --environment-data azuredevops-scope='{}' --offerings [0].cspm-monitor-azuredevops='{}'

Onboard GitHub Environment

az security security-connectors create --location CentralUS --name githubConnector --resource-group myResourceGroup --hierarchy-identifier 8b090c71-cfba-494d-87a6-e10b321a0d95 --environment-name GitHub --environment-data github-scope='{}' --offerings [0].cspm-monitor-github='{}'

Onboard GitLab Environment

az security security-connectors create --location CentralUS --name gitlabConnector --resource-group myResourceGroup --hierarchy-identifier 8b090c71-cfba-494d-87a6-e10b321a0d93 --environment-name GitLab --environment-data gitlab-scope='{}' --offerings [0].cspm-monitor-gitlab='{}'

Required Parameters

--name --security-connector-name -n

The security connector name.

--resource-group -g

Name of resource group. You can configure the default group using az configure --defaults group=<name>.

Optional Parameters

--environment-data

The security connector environment data. Support shorthand-syntax, json-file and yaml-file. Try "??" to show more.

--environment-name

The multi cloud resource's cloud name.

Accepted values: AWS, Azure, AzureDevOps, GCP, GitLab, Github
--hierarchy-identifier

The multi cloud resource identifier (account id in case of AWS connector, project number in case of GCP connector, GUID in case DevOps connector).

--location -l

Location where the resource is stored.

--offerings

A collection of offerings for the security connector. Support shorthand-syntax, json-file and yaml-file. Try "??" to show more.

--tags

A list of key value pairs that describe the resource. Support shorthand-syntax, json-file and yaml-file. Try "??" to show more.

az security security-connector list

Preview

Command group 'az security security-connector' is in preview and under development. Reference and support levels: https://aka.ms/CLI_refstatus

List all the security connectors in the specified subscription.

az security security-connector list [--max-items]
                                    [--next-token]
                                    [--resource-group]

Optional Parameters

--max-items

Total number of items to return in the command's output. If the total number of items available is more than the value specified, a token is provided in the command's output. To resume pagination, provide the token value in --next-token argument of a subsequent command.

--next-token

Token to specify where to start paginating. This is the token value from a previously truncated response.

--resource-group -g

Name of resource group. You can configure the default group using az configure --defaults group=<name>.

az security security-connector update

Preview

Command group 'az security security-connector' is in preview and under development. Reference and support levels: https://aka.ms/CLI_refstatus

Update a security connector.

az security security-connector update [--add]
                                      [--environment-data]
                                      [--environment-name {AWS, Azure, AzureDevOps, GCP, GitLab, Github}]
                                      [--force-string {0, 1, f, false, n, no, t, true, y, yes}]
                                      [--ids]
                                      [--location]
                                      [--name]
                                      [--offerings]
                                      [--remove]
                                      [--resource-group]
                                      [--set]
                                      [--subscription]
                                      [--tags]

Optional Parameters

--add

Add an object to a list of objects by specifying a path and key value pairs. Example: --add property.listProperty <key=value, string or JSON string>.

--environment-data

The security connector environment data. Support shorthand-syntax, json-file and yaml-file. Try "??" to show more.

--environment-name

The multi cloud resource's cloud name.

Accepted values: AWS, Azure, AzureDevOps, GCP, GitLab, Github
--force-string

When using 'set' or 'add', preserve string literals instead of attempting to convert to JSON.

Accepted values: 0, 1, f, false, n, no, t, true, y, yes
--ids

One or more resource IDs (space-delimited). It should be a complete resource ID containing all information of 'Resource Id' arguments. You should provide either --ids or other 'Resource Id' arguments.

--location -l

Location where the resource is stored.

--name --security-connector-name -n

The security connector name.

--offerings

A collection of offerings for the security connector. Support shorthand-syntax, json-file and yaml-file. Try "??" to show more.

--remove

Remove a property or an element from a list. Example: --remove property.list OR --remove propertyToRemove.

--resource-group -g

Name of resource group. You can configure the default group using az configure --defaults group=<name>.

--set

Update an object by specifying a property path and value to set. Example: --set property1.property2=.

--subscription

Name or ID of subscription. You can configure the default subscription using az account set -s NAME_OR_ID.

--tags

A list of key value pairs that describe the resource. Support shorthand-syntax, json-file and yaml-file. Try "??" to show more.
